What are the prices for health insurance examination and treatment services? What costs make up the structure of health insurance examination and treatment services?

1. Latest price of health insurance examination and treatment services

The latest prices for health examination and treatment services under health insurance are stipulated in Article 2 of Circular 22/2023/TT-BYT as follows:

- Prices for medical examination and consultation services are specified in Appendix I.

- Bed day service price according to regulations in Appendix II.

- Technical service and testing prices are as prescribed in Appendix III.

- Add notes of some technical services as prescribed in Appendix IV.

- The price of technical services performed by anesthesia does not include the cost of drugs and oxygen used for the service as prescribed in Appendix V. The cost of drugs and oxygen will be paid to the social insurance agency and the patient based on actual usage and the results of the unit's procurement bidding.

2. Structure of health insurance examination and treatment services

According to Article 3 of Circular 22/2023/TT-BYT, the price of health examination and treatment services under health insurance is built on the basis of direct costs and salaries to ensure medical examination and treatment, specifically as follows:

(1) Direct costs included in the price of medical examination services:

- Costs of clothes, hats, masks, sheets, pillows, mattresses, mats, stationery, gloves, cotton, bandages, alcohol, gauze, saline solution and other consumables for medical examination;

- Costs of electricity; water; fuel; treatment of domestic waste, medical waste (solid, liquid); washing, ironing, steaming, drying, washing, sterilizing fabrics, examination instruments; costs of cleaning and ensuring environmental hygiene; supplies, chemicals for disinfection and anti-infection during medical examination:

- Costs for maintenance and repair of houses, equipment, purchase of replacement assets, tools and instruments such as: air conditioners, computers, printers, dehumidifiers, fans, tables, chairs, beds, cabinets, lighting, other necessary kits and tools during the medical examination process.

(2) Direct costs included in the price of hospital bed service:

- Costs of clothes, hats, masks, blankets, sheets, pillows, mattresses, curtains, mats; stationery; gloves used in examination, injection, infusion, cotton, bandages, alcohol, gauze, saline solution and other consumables for daily care and treatment (including costs for changing wound dressings or surgical incisions for inpatients, except for cases paid outside the daily bed service price specified in Clause 5 and Clause 6, Article 7 of Circular 22/2023/TT-BYT); electrodes, ECG cables, blood pressure cuffs, SPO2 cables during the use of patient monitors for emergency and intensive care beds.

- The costs specified in Point b and Point c, Clause 1, Article 3 of Circular 22/2023/TT-BYT serve the care and treatment of patients according to professional requirements.

- The costs of drugs, whole blood, blood products that meet standards, infusion fluids, medical equipment (in addition to the above-mentioned supplies); all types of syringes, needles, needles used for injection and infusion; feeding pumps; infusion lines, connecting tubes, connecting wires for electric syringes, infusion machines used for injection and infusion; oxygen, oxygen breathing tubes, oxygen breathing masks (except for cases where patients are prescribed to use mechanical ventilation) are not included in the price structure of hospital bed-day services and are paid according to actual use for the patient.

(3) Direct costs included in technical service prices:

- Costs of clothes, hats, masks, sheets, pillows, mattresses, mats, fabric items; stationery; medicine, infusion, chemicals, consumables, replacement materials used in the process of performing technical services;

- The costs specified in Point b and Point c, Clause 1, Article 3 of Circular 22/2023/TT-BYT serve the implementation of technical services according to professional requirements.

(4) Salary costs included in the price of medical examination services, hospital bed day services and technical services, including:

- Salary, rank, position, allowances, contributions according to the regime prescribed by the State for public service units and basic salary prescribed in Decree 24/2023/ND-CP;

- Permanent allowance, surgery and procedure allowance according to Decision 73/2011/QD-TTg.

(5) Salary costs in the price of medical examination and treatment services prescribed in Clause 4, Article 3 of Circular 22/2023/TT-BYT do not include expenses under the regime guaranteed by the state budget according to the following legal provisions:

- Preferential allowances, attraction allowances, subsidies and other incentives for medical officers, civil servants, contract workers and military medical officers and staff directly performing medical professional work at State medical facilities in areas with particularly difficult socio-economic conditions;

- Attraction allowance, long-term service allowance, some subsidies and payment of travel expenses for cadres, civil servants, public employees and salary earners in the armed forces (people's army and people's police) working in areas with particularly difficult socio-economic conditions;

- Special allowance regime for officers and civil servants working at Friendship Hospital, Thong Nhat Hospital, Da Nang C Hospital under the Ministry of Health, Central Health Protection Departments 1, 2, 2B, 3 and 5, Department A11 of 108 Central Military Hospital and Department A11 of the Military Traditional Medicine Institute;

- Special allowances according to profession or job.

(6) Payment of medical examination and treatment costs between social insurance agencies and medical examination and treatment facilities according to service prices prescribed in this Circular and costs of drugs, whole blood, standard blood products, chemicals, medical equipment not included in service prices (specifically noted in services) according to the payment principles prescribed in Article 24 of Decree 146/2018/ND-CP as amended and supplemented by Decree 75/2023/ND-CP.

Note: The costs specified in 1, 2, 3 and 4 are determined based on economic and technical norms, cost norms issued by competent authorities, prices of cost factors, actual and reasonable cost levels according to current policies and regulations, ensuring averageness, progress, and meeting service quality requirements.

Economic and technical norms are the basis for establishing prices for medical examination and treatment services and cannot be used as a basis for payment for each specific medical examination and treatment service (except for some special cases specified in Clause 6, Article 5, Clause 16, Article 6 and Clause 8, Article 7 of Circular 22/2023/TT-BYT).
